Understanding Dutch Phone Numbers

Before diving into the search methods, it's important to understand the structure of Dutch phone numbers. The Netherlands uses a system of area codes followed by subscriber numbers. These area codes can indicate the geographic location of the number or the type of service it provides. For example, numbers starting with 06 are typically mobile numbers, while those starting with 020 are usually located in Amsterdam. Knowing this structure can help you narrow down your search.

The country code for the Netherlands is +31. When calling from outside the Netherlands, you'll need to dial this code followed by the area code (without the leading zero) and the subscriber number. For instance, if a number in Amsterdam is 020-1234567, you would dial +31 20 1234567 from abroad. Understanding this format ensures you can successfully connect when calling from international locations.

Furthermore, be aware of different types of numbers. Aside from geographic and mobile numbers, there are also toll-free numbers (starting with 0800), premium-rate numbers (starting with 0900), and shared-cost numbers (starting with 088). Each of these has different implications for the caller in terms of cost and service provided. Always be mindful of the number type you are calling to avoid unexpected charges.

Utilizing Online Search Engines

One of the most straightforward methods to find a contact number in the Netherlands is by using online search engines like Google, Bing, or DuckDuckGo. Simply type in the name of the business or organization you're trying to reach, followed by the word "telefoonnummer" (Dutch for phone number) or "contact." For example, if you're looking for the phone number of a specific bank, you might search for "ABN AMRO telefoonnummer." Often, the search engine will display the contact number directly in the search results or provide a link to the company's website where you can find it.

When using search engines, be specific with your keywords. Instead of just searching for "restaurant Amsterdam," try "Restaurant De Blauwe Gek Amsterdam telefoonnummer." The more specific you are, the higher the chance of finding the exact number you need. Also, try searching in both English and Dutch, as some companies may list their contact information in only one language.

Another useful trick is to use the search engine's advanced search operators. For example, you can use the "site:" operator to search only within a specific website. If you know the company has a website but can't find the contact number on the homepage, you can try searching for "telefoonnummer site:companywebsite.nl." This will limit the search results to only that website, making it easier to locate the contact information.

Exploring Online Directories and Websites

Several online directories and websites specialize in listing contact information for businesses and individuals in the Netherlands. These directories can be a valuable resource when you're struggling to find a number through general search engines. Some popular options include:

  • De Telefoongids: This is the official online phone directory of the Netherlands. It allows you to search for both residential and business numbers. You can search by name, address, or business category.
  • Telefoonboek.nl: Similar to De Telefoongids, Telefoonboek.nl provides a comprehensive listing of phone numbers in the Netherlands. It also offers reverse phone lookup, allowing you to identify the owner of a phone number.
  • Bedrijven Telefoongids: This directory focuses specifically on business listings. It allows you to search for companies by industry, location, and name.
  • LinkedIn: While primarily a professional networking platform, LinkedIn can also be a useful resource for finding contact information for individuals working in specific companies in the Netherlands. You may find phone numbers listed on their profiles or be able to connect with them and request the information directly.

When using these directories, remember to double-check the information. Contact details can sometimes be outdated, so it's always a good idea to verify the number through another source if possible. Additionally, be aware of privacy settings. Some individuals may choose not to list their phone numbers in public directories, so you may not always be able to find the number you're looking for.

Contacting Information Services

If you've exhausted all other options and are still unable to find the contact number you need, you can try contacting information services. These services specialize in providing contact information for businesses and individuals. Keep in mind that these services may charge a fee for their assistance.

One option is to call the Dutch information line at 1888. This service can provide contact information for businesses and government agencies. However, be aware that the cost of calling this number can be relatively high.

Another option is to use online information services like infobel.com. These services allow you to search for contact information for businesses and individuals in the Netherlands. They may offer both free and paid search options, with the paid options providing more detailed information.

When using information services, always be clear about the information you're looking for and the reason you need it. This will help the service provider find the most accurate and relevant contact information for you.
